Fri, 22 Oct 2010, 07:00 pmWe have been using two revolving stages on our latest production and during last nights performance our one controller died , someone let the smoke out ! These controllers , we discover , were made over 40 years ago , so we thought maybe we should update our technology but do not know where to start . Can anyone help and point us in the right direction ? Ta
Sounds like a contactor
Sat, 30 Oct 2010, 02:56 pmSounds like a contactor coil burnt out, or if you are unlucky a motor has burnt out.
Start by getting an electrician to look at the controller and motors, as david has said, sometimes it is worth keeping the old simpler controller going, unless you need your revolve to go to preset points, accurately.
